Enrollment Status Verification Update - Accepting iGROW, NES and SWSP Data

04/08/2026

2024-2025 Enrollment Verification Data Due May 7, 2026

(For the First Time: Data Now Being Accepted for iGROW, NES, and SWSP)

ISAC is now accepting 2024-2025 enrollment verification data for students who previously received funds from certain ISAC-administered programs.

  • Enrollment verification data for the Illinois Graduate Retain Our Workforce (iGROW) Tech Scholarship Program, Nursing Education Scholarship (NES), and Post Master of Social Work School Social Work Professional Educator License Scholarship Program (SWSP) is available via each program's system within the GAP Access portal. The enrollment verification data for Illinois Special Education Teacher Tuition Waiver (SETTW) Program and the Minority Teachers if Illinois (MTI) Scholarship Program will continue to follow the same procedures.
  • Data is to be completed by the college and returned to ISAC as soon as possible, verifying award recipients' current enrollment status. In order to be considered timely, all data must be submitted on or before Thursday, May 7, 2026.
  • As a reminder, ISAC monitors recipients' fulfillment of the program requirements because, if recipients fail to meet the applicable requirements, their awards convert to loans that must be repaid.
    • Knowing recipients' enrollment status, as reported by the colleges, allows ISAC to communicate with recipients who have graduated (or otherwise stopped attending college) regarding the steps they need to take in order to fulfill program requirements.
    • The sooner colleges submit enrollment verification data to ISAC, the sooner ISAC can communicate with impacted award recipients.

Reporting Enrollment Status

  • For iGROW, NES, and SWSP:
    • From the iGROW, NES or SWSP system "Home" page within GAP Access, select the prior academic year (in this case, "2024-2025") from the "Academic Year" drop-down menu, and then click on the "Enrollment Status Verification" tab.
    • If the current academic year (in this case, "2025-2026") is selected, the "Enrollment Status Verification" listing will be blank.
    • The reason the academic year must be selected for enrollment verification is that other functionalities (for example, certification and payment) also reside in the NES and SWSP systems.
  • Data should be reported based on each student's last date of enrollment in the required program.
  • If the "Enrollment Status" is anything other than "In School," the "Effective Date" also must be provided. A listing of valid "Enrollment Status" options may be found in the Enrollment Status Verification User Guide.
  • If the student remains enrolled in the required program for 2025-2026, indicate such with the "In School" status; those students will continue to appear with future-year data.

Reminder: In order for staff to view enrollment status verification data, the institution's GAP Access administrator must ensure that access to this functionality has been granted (both for themselves and other staff, as appropriate). Further details regarding this process are provided in the "Security Access" section that appears at the bottom of this message.

Making Revisions After Data Has Been Submitted

Enrollment status verification data is available to be updated only if the information has not yet been submitted to ISAC. Colleges must contact Partner Services at [email protected] for changes that need to be made after the data has been submitted.

Security Access

GAP Access User Guides provide institutions with step-by-step instructions for activating and monitoring user accounts. All users need a valid GAP Access ID and password to access the system. ISAC relies on a designated Primary Administrator (usually, the financial aid director) at each institution to authorize users and provide them with the appropriate level of access for each ISAC program.

Enrollment verification functionality for these programs is available each day between 7:00 a.m. and 10:00 p.m. (CT).
